Background
The switch machine switches the switch points, locks the points and indicates the point position safety equipment. The indicating mechanism of the switch machine has inseparable relation with the power, transmission and locking mechanism, and is an important component of the safety performance of the switch machine. At present, the current status of the representation system of the turnout switch machine in China is as follows:
the system has poor mechanical transmission stability, large position change between the movable contact and the static contact, inconsistent and dynamic elastic deformation borne by the two static contact pieces due to errors of machining and assembling, and the contact area of the contact ring and the contact pieces can be changed every time. Therefore, the constant change in contact resistance further degrades the reliability of the contact, and the user has to perform periodic maintenance and troubleshooting.
Over the years, numerous manufacturers have made various improvements and applications, but none have ultimately solved the failure and maintenance issues in the application.
At present, the safety protection of the turnout switching system in China on the turnout squeezing has the following method:
the point switch has one extruding and cutting device inside the point switch, and when the wheel is extruded to switch, the extruding and cutting pin in the device is disconnected and the indicating circuit is cut off to protect the extruded switch. Therefore, the failure of the pinch-off pin to not pinch off by itself frequently occurs.
And secondly, a special mechanism for squeezing the switch is arranged in the point switch, and a special connecting device is arranged on the mounting device, so that the mechanism in the point switch is increased, the complexity of the mounting device is increased, the switch tie space is occupied, and the difficulty is increased for line maintenance.
And thirdly, arranging a close contact inspection device at the switch point of the turnout switch rail, wherein the close contact inspection device is used for inspecting the close contact state of the switch rail and finishing the function of indicating the extruded turnout, and the turnout switch rail with a small number only having one switching point cannot be installed due to serious insufficient space.

Detailed Description
As shown in fig. 1, a presentation unit for a point switch machine comprises a transmission shaft and an action rod; the action rod 203 is synchronously provided with an action plate 210, the two end ports of the action plate 210 are movably provided with an actuating sheet 303, a transmission shaft 305 synchronously arranged on the actuating sheet 303 is in transmission connection with a rotary joint 306, the rotary joint 306 is in selective electric contact with a joint in a joint group, the bottom of the rotary joint 306 is connected with a locking column 304 through a transmission piece, and the locking column 304 is locked with a rod indicating notch.
The unit accurately completes the action sequence of the point switch specified by the national standard, immediately disconnects the indication contact after the point switch receives the switch point rail instruction, and provides a circuit contact condition for executing a reverse direction operation instruction; after the switch rail reaches the specified position and is checked by the indicating rod, a circuit for indicating the switch rail position of the turnout is switched on, and an action circuit of the switch machine is switched off; when the accident of squeezing the switch occurs, the switch indication circuit is reliably cut off. The specific implementation is as follows:
as shown in fig. 1, 2 and 3, the rotary joint 306 is provided with a spring 307 at the end. When the switch machine receives a switch switching instruction, the action plate 210 moves rightwards, the upper inclined surface of the action plate 210 pushes the right starting sheet 303 to rotate for a certain angle, and meanwhile, the rotary contact 306 is driven to do corresponding movement, 4 rows of contacts are disconnected, and an original representation circuit is cut off. The action plate 210 continues to move rightwards, after the locking stroke is finished, the left starting sheet 303 quickly falls into the bottom plane of the action plate 210 under the action of the rotary contact tension spring to drive the rotary contact to rotate, the power supply is quickly cut off, and the reverse position is switched on for indication. The action state of the contact group is the same as that of the current turnout control circuit.
As shown in fig. 1 and 4, the indication rod comprises a close contact side indication rod 603 and a repulsion side indication rod 604, and the bottom of the locking column 304 is provided with a translational fit with a notch of the repulsion side indication rod 604.
The close-contact side indicating lever 603 and the repulsive side indicating lever 604 are shown in a locked state. When a branch is crowded, the repulsion side indicating rod 604 moves in the direction shown in the figure according to the motion track of the repulsion switch rail in front of the first traction point, the gap of the repulsion side indicating rod 604 and the lower end of the locking column 304 are both provided with inclined surfaces, and the two inclined surfaces interact with each other to enable the locking column 304 to move upwards to drive the rotating contact to rotate to disconnect the indicating contact, so that the indication of the branch-crowded breaking is realized.
